  • 11:30 - 12:20
    Diagnose and characterize embedded systems in correlated radio, analog and digital domains
    Tadeusz Asyngier - Tektronix | Tespol

    Diagnosing and troubleshooting embedded systems often requires observing signals across multiple domains—digital, analog, RF, and modulation. Only complete time correlation between these domains allows for the isolation of potential issues, such as determining whether a theoretically correct (from a protocol standpoint) command to retune the carrier frequency of an RF signal and transmit a modulated digital signal over the radio layer, intended to perform a specific function in the system, was actually executed properly—and whether the system fulfilled the designer’s functional expectations.

    For decades, engineers have relied on specialized measurement instruments—such as logic analyzers, oscilloscopes, and spectrum analyzers—synchronizing them via triggering to maintain temporal correlation. However, the barrier has always been the high total cost of such a system and the lack of fully integrated visualization of time-correlated waveforms across different domains.

    A solution to this problem is the concept of the MDO (Mixed Domain Oscilloscope), introduced by Tektronix and developed over the past decade. During the presentation, Tadeusz Asyngier will explain how such a device works and highlight practical ways to use it in the embedded system design cycle.

  • 12:25 - 12:55
    Component Reclaim – a green solution for the electronic industry
    Gary Moffat - European Sales Manager - Retronix

    In electronics the circular economy embodies strategies to extend product lifecycles & promote reuse. Factronix is a company that has extensive experience in this field, so during the speech it will talk about what related services are important and why.

    The lecture will therefore focus on issues such as Component Recovery, Laser Reballing, Retinning, Test Services, that is, services which involve giving a second life to electronic components that would otherwise be discarded, turning potential waste into valuable resources.

  • 13:00 - 14:00
    Everything can be hacked
    Piotr Konieczny - CEO - Niebezpiecznik

    In an era of growing digital threats, cybersecurity is more critical than ever in safeguarding data, infrastructure, and businesses. But this raises an important question: is any system truly secure, or can every security measure be breached?

    In this presentation, cybersecurity expert Piotr Konieczny will explore real-world cyberattack scenarios, revealing how hackers bypass security systems and exploit unexpected vulnerabilities. As the founder of Niebezpiecznik, Poland’s leading cybersecurity website, he will shed light on the most common mistakes companies make and outline practical and effective strategies to defend against cyber threats.

    This presentation isn’t just for cybersecurity professionals. Engineers, managers, and anyone concerned about protecting their personal or corporate data will gain valuable insights into how to strengthen their defences and better protect their data and systems.

  • 14:35 - 15:15
    Top 20 of Europe’s defence industry: Where the money, technology and influence are
    Ewelina Bednarz - Global Content Manager - Evertiq

    Evertiq has repeatedly reported on the growing geopolitical tensions and the ongoing war in Ukraine — developments that have significantly changed, and continue to reshape, the landscape of Europe’s defence industry. That is why we have decided to present a ranking of the 20 most important defence companies in Europe — those setting the direction of development, attracting the largest contracts, and shaping the future of security on the Old Continent. We will look not only at the numbers, but also at the growing role of advanced technologies — from electronics to cybersecurity solutions. Particular attention will be given to those companies which, beyond manufacturing hardware, are actively building Europe’s digital shield.

  • 11:00 - 12:30
    Oscilloscope Measurement Workshop
    Janusz Kostyra - Measurement Equipment Specialists - AM Technologies
    Stefan Misztal - Measurement Equipment Specialists - AM Technologies

    During the workshop, participants will become familiar with the architecture, measurement capabilities, and key technical parameters of modern digital oscilloscopes. They will also conduct measurements independently.

     

    The workshop consists of two parts:

    • Introductory Lecture – covering architecture, key parameters, and operating modes.
    • Hands-on Session – using an oscilloscope and a built-in signal generator to acquire signals, perform measurements, and analyze the collected data.
